What’s going to happen in the job searching and employment market in 2012? Can anyone make an accurate prediction? The latest statistics on unemployment rate as of October 2011 was at 3.0%, one of the lowest in months. It was at 3.7% in July 2010. This little fact should boosts employees confidence on the economy and employment market in general. Unless something adverse or dramatic event takes place, it’s a safe bet to predict a healthy job market to continue throughout 2012.
